The Means Test
The changes to the bankruptcy law in 2005 have resulted in the use of a means test to determine eligibility for Chapter 7 filing. The means test is based on household size and median income. Generally a single person making less than $44,000 per year is eligible to file for Chapter 7. Even if you make more than this amount you may be able to qualify. The Automatic Stay
If you are being hounded by creditors who call and e-mail at all hours, or if you are in danger of car repossession, wage garnishment or even home foreclosure, bankruptcy may provide the relief you need. When you file for bankruptcy an automatic stay is put into place.
The automatic stay immediately prevents creditors from continuing to contact you, temporarily stops foreclosure actions, repossession and wage garnishments.
